In a world ravaged by centuries of war between humans and vampires, humanity lives in walled cities controlled by a totalitarian church. The "Priests" are elite warriors trained in vampire combat who were disbanded and marginalized after the last war. When a veteran Priest's niece is abducted by a new pack of highly evolved vampires, he breaks his sacred vows to hunt them down before they turn her. "Filmyzilla" is a notorious public torrent website that illegally distributes copyrighted material, including Hollywood, Bollywood, and regional Indian films. When users append "updated" or "filmyzilla" to a movie title, they are typically looking for a free, downloadable file of the film in formats like dual-audio (English/Hindi), 480p, 720p, or 1080p web-rips. A review of domain registration data shows that the original FilmyZilla.com was registered back in 2017. However, "updated" domains like FilmyZilla34.com appeared as recently as August 2025. This constant creation of new "updated" websites makes it incredibly difficult for authorities to shut them down permanently.
